What is the result of dividing a whole number by a unit fraction?

Back

To divide a whole number by a unit fraction, multiply the whole number by the reciprocal of the fraction.

If you have 6 cups of flour and each batch of pancakes requires 1/2 cup, how many batches can you make?

Back

You can make 12 batches of pancakes.

If Karen has an 18-pound bag of rabbit food and uses 1/3 pound each day, how many days will it last?

Back

The bag will last for 54 days.
